During Hollywood's Golden Age, women like Greta Garbo, Marlene Dietrich, and Bette Davis dominated the silver screen. These iconic actresses, now considered legends, were often cast in leading roles that showcased their talent and charisma. However, as the years went by, the opportunities for women in Hollywood began to dwindle. One of the most significant developments in recent years has been the creation of complex, nuanced characters for mature women. Shows like "The Crown" and "Big Little Lies" feature women over 40 as central characters, with rich backstories and multifaceted personalities. These characters are not simply defined by their age or relationships to men; they are fully realized human beings with their own agency and motivations. The entertainment industry has long been a reflection of societal values and cultural norms. When it comes to the representation of mature women in entertainment and cinema, there has been a significant shift over the years. From being relegated to secondary roles or typecast in stereotypical characters, mature women are now taking center stage, showcasing their talent, and redefining what it means to age in the public eye.
